Optimizing Futures Position Sizing for Risk Control
Futures trading, particularly in the volatile world of cryptocurrency, offers significant potential for profit. However, it also carries a substantial degree of risk. While a winning trading strategy is crucial, it's often *how* you manage your capital – specifically, position sizing – that separates consistently profitable traders from those who quickly deplete their accounts. This article provides a detailed guide to optimizing your futures position sizing for effective risk control, geared towards beginners but valuable for traders of all experience levels.
Understanding the Core Concept
Position sizing is the process of determining how much capital to allocate to a single trade. It's not about how *right* you are about a trade’s direction, but about how much you *risk* when you are wrong. Many novice traders fall into the trap of believing a strong conviction in a trade justifies a larger position size. This is a dangerous mindset. Proper position sizing ensures that even losing trades don’t significantly impact your overall trading capital, allowing you to stay in the game and capitalize on future opportunities. It is intrinsically linked to risk management, and a disciplined approach to both is paramount for long-term success.
Why Position Sizing is Critical in Crypto Futures
Cryptocurrency futures are known for their extreme volatility. Rapid price swings can quickly turn a seemingly profitable trade into a substantial loss. Leverage, a defining feature of futures contracts, amplifies both potential gains *and* potential losses. Without careful position sizing, leverage can decimate your account during unexpected market movements.
Consider this: a 10% move against your position with 10x leverage isn’t a 10% loss – it’s a 100% loss. Effective position sizing mitigates this risk by limiting the amount of capital exposed to any single trade. It allows you to weather market storms and maintain a consistent trading approach, rather than being driven by fear or greed. Key Factors Influencing Position Size
Several factors should be considered when determining your optimal position size:
- Account Size: This is the foundation. Your total trading capital dictates how much risk you can afford to take.
- Risk Tolerance: How much of your account are you comfortable losing on a single trade? This is a personal decision, but a common guideline is to risk no more than 1-2% of your account per trade. More conservative traders may opt for 0.5% or less.
- Stop-Loss Level: A stop-loss order is essential for limiting potential losses. The distance between your entry price and your stop-loss price directly impacts your risk exposure.
- Volatility: More volatile assets require smaller position sizes. Consider the Average True Range (ATR) or historical volatility data when assessing risk.
- Leverage: Higher leverage amplifies risk, necessitating smaller position sizes.
- Trading Strategy: The win rate and reward/risk ratio of your strategy influence appropriate position sizing. A high-probability strategy might allow for slightly larger positions, while a higher-risk strategy demands more conservative sizing.

Common Position Sizing Methods
Here are some popular methods for calculating position size:
1. Fixed Fractional Position Sizing:
This is arguably the most widely recommended method for beginners. It involves risking a fixed percentage of your account on each trade.
- Formula:*
Position Size = (Account Size * Risk Percentage) / (Entry Price – Stop-Loss Price)
- Example:*
Account Size: $10,000 Risk Percentage: 1% ($100) Entry Price (BTC/USDT): $50,000 Stop-Loss Price: $49,000
Position Size = ($10,000 * 0.01) / ($50,000 - $49,000) = $100 / $1,000 = 0.1 BTC
This means you would buy or sell 0.1 BTC futures contract.

3. Kelly Criterion (Advanced):
The Kelly Criterion is a more complex formula that aims to maximize long-term growth. However, it’s highly sensitive to accurate estimations of win rate and reward/risk ratio. Incorrect estimations can lead to over-leveraging and significant losses. It’s generally not recommended for beginners.
- Formula:*
f* = (bp - q) / b
Where:
- f* = Optimal fraction of capital to bet
- b = Net profit received per unit bet (Reward/Risk Ratio - 1)
- p = Probability of winning
- q = Probability of losing (1 - p)
4. Volatility-Adjusted Position Sizing:
This method adjusts position size based on the asset's volatility. Higher volatility leads to smaller positions.
- Formula:*
Position Size = (Account Size * Risk Percentage) / (ATR * Multiplier)
Where:
- ATR = Average True Range (a measure of volatility)
- Multiplier = A factor that determines how much volatility to account for (e.g., 2, 3, or 4)

Common Mistakes to Avoid
- Martingale Strategy: Increasing your position size after a loss to recover losses is extremely dangerous and often leads to account blow-up.
- Over-Leveraging: Using excessive leverage without proper risk management is a recipe for disaster.
- Ignoring Stop-Losses: Failing to set and adhere to stop-loss orders is a critical error.
- Emotional Trading: Letting fear or greed dictate your position size.
- Not Adjusting to Market Conditions: Using the same position size regardless of volatility or news events.
- Averaging Down: Adding to a losing position, hoping to lower your average entry price.
Backtesting and Refinement
Once you’ve chosen a position sizing method, it’s crucial to backtest it using historical data. This will help you evaluate its effectiveness and identify any potential weaknesses. Adjust your parameters (risk percentage, multipliers, etc.) based on your backtesting results. Remember that past performance is not indicative of future results, but backtesting provides valuable insights.
